      • 내산화성 초미립 Fe-Co분말 제조와 자기적 특성에 관한 연구

        임재성,강신우,김영삼 동아대학교 공과대학부설 생산기술연구소 1998 生産技術硏究所硏究論文集 Vol.3 No.2

        Ultra fine Fe-Co particle with oxidation resistance was produced by reducing the silica coated Co-ferrite particle with H_2 at 500℃. When the silica coated Co-ferrite particle was reduced in H_2 at 500℃ for 6 hrs, the silica coated Fe-Co particle(SiO_2/Fe-Co=3.6wt%) showed following properties, e.g, high oxidation resistance below 150℃ , magnetization value of 154.4 emu/g and the size range between 30 and 290Å(mean particle size of 94Å)

        부분 폐색 영역의 GAN 기반 복원을 통한 효과적 얼굴인식 기법

        임재성,홍충표 한국차세대컴퓨팅학회 2022 한국차세대컴퓨팅학회 논문지 Vol.18 No.5

        In the vision-based object recognition, there are practically various limitations to always proceed with the identification based on the optimal image. For example, a part of the object may be occluded due to the presence of an object causing interference when acquiring an image of the object of interest. Even in the face classification of a person, if there is an occlusion such as a mask, there may be a problem that the accuracy is lowered when the classification is performed through the conventional trained model. To overcome this, we propose a pipeline that combines the GAN-based occlusion area restoration technique and the ArcFace Loss model, a machine learning algorithm based on the distance of the embedding vector, to increase the recognition accuracy of partially occluded faces. In this paper, the performance is evaluated based on the classification of a mask-wearing person, a representative example of an occluded face image. As a result, performance improvements of 68% and 0.62 were confirmed in Accuracy and F-1 Score, respectively, compared to conventional face learning. 비전 기반의 객체 인식에 있어 항상 최적의 영상을 기반으로 식별을 진행하기에는 현실적으로 다양한 제약이 존재한다. 예를 들어, 관심 객체의 영상획득 시 간섭을 일으키는 물체의 존재와 같은 이유로 인해 객체의 일부가 가려져 있을 수 있다. 인물의 얼굴 분류에 있어서도 마스크와 같은 폐색물이 존재할 경우 원래의 학습된 모델을 통한 분류 진행시 정확도가 떨어지는 문제가 발생할 수 있다. 이를 극복하기 위하여 GAN 기반의 폐색 영역 복원 기법 및 임베딩 벡터의 거리에 따른 학습 알고리즘인 ArcFace Loss 모델을 결합한 파이프라인을 제안해 부분 폐색된 얼굴의 인식률을 높이고자 한다. 본 논문에서는 폐색된 얼굴 이미지의 대표적인 예인 마스크 착용 인물의 학습 및 분류를 바탕으로 성능을 평가한다. 결과로 Accuracy와 F-1 Score에서 일반적인 얼굴 학습에 비하여 각기 68%와 0.62의 성능향상을 확인하였다.

      • 전립선 비대증 진단에 있어서 전립선 이행대 용적 지수의 유용성

        임재성,노안식,김용웅,육승모 충남대학교 의과대학 의학연구소 2003 충남의대잡지 Vol.30 No.1

        Purpose : Prostate volume has been poorly correlated to various parameters used to assess benign prostatic hyperplasia (BPH), including symptom score, peak urine flow and detrusor pressure at peak urine flow. The purpose of this study was 2-fold: 1) to determine if transrectal ultrasound measurement of the transition zone of the prostate served as a better proxy for determining prostate size and correlated better with IPSS, peak urine flow and detrusor pressure and 2) if the parameter transition zone index (the ratio between transition zone volume and prostate volume) was useful in evaluating clinical prostatism. Materials and Methods: We prospectively evaluated 30 men with symptomatic BPH (mean age 65.4 years) according to symptom sore, peak urine flow, pressure/flow study, transrectal ultrasound volume of the entire prostate and the transition zone and calculation of the transition zone index. Results : There was a week correlation between prostate volume and symptom score, peak urine flow and detrusor pressure at peak urine flow: a stronger correlation between volume of transition zone and symptom score (r=0.679 p=0.03), and peak urine flow (r=-0.672 p=0.05) and a significant correlation (p=0.001) between transition zone index and symptom score (r=0.868), and peak urine flow(r=-0.870). Conclusion : Transition zone index is a parameter that correlates siginificantly with parameters of BPH and may serve as a useful proxy for evaluating worsening obstruction. Studies are underway to determine whether transtion zone index can be used prospectively to predict and correlate response with therapies designed to ablate prostatic tissue medically or surgically.

        High-Performance Schottky Junction for Self-Powered, Ultrafast, Broadband Alternating Current Photodetector

        임재성,KUMARMOHIT,서형탁 한국재료학회 2022 한국재료학회지 Vol.32 No.8

        In this work, we developed silver nanowires and a silicon based Schottky junction and demonstrated ultrafast broadband photosensing behavior. The current device had a response speed that was ultrafast, with a rising time of 36 μs and a falling time of 382 μs, and it had a high level of repeatability across a broad spectrum of wavelengths (λ = 365 to 940 nm). Furthermore, it exhibited excellent responsivity of 60 mA/W and a significant detectivity of 3.5 × 1012 Jones at a λ = 940 nm with an intensity of 0.2 mW cm2 under zero bias operating voltage, which reflects a boost of 50%, by using the AC PV effect. This excellent broadband performance was caused by the photon-induced alternative photocurrent effect, which changed the way the optoelectronics work. This innovative approach will open a second door to the potential design of a broadband ultrafast device for use in cutting-edge optoelectronics.

        계통 안정도 모의를 통한 전력계통의 무력화 방안

        임재성,강현구,김택원,문승일,임완권,Lim, Jae-Sung,Kang, Hyun-Koo,Kim, Taek-Won,Moon, Seung-Il,Lim, Wan-Khun 한국군사과학기술학회 2009 한국군사과학기술학회지 Vol.12 No.4

        When assailing some area, it is important to consider targeting power system. This paper describes effective method that power networks are incapacitated based on assessing TSI and VDI. For this, we compose realistic scenario and analyze the simulation results in a view of stability. The simulation results show the destruction effects when occur the contingency in the specified area. To perform this process, the simulation tool PSS/E and DSAT are used.

        Organic Thin Film Transistors with Gate Dielectrics of Plasma Polymerized Styrene and Vinyl Acetate Thin Films

        임재성,신백균,이붕주 한국전기전자재료학회 2015 Transactions on Electrical and Electronic Material Vol.16 No.2

        Organic polymer dielectric thin films of styrene and vinyl acetate were prepared by the plasma polymerizationdeposition technique and applied for the fabrication of an organic thin film transistor device. The structural propertiesof the plasma polymerized thin films were characterized by Fourier-transform infrared spectroscopy, X-ray diffraction,atomic force microscopy, and contact angle measurement. Investigation of the electrical properties of the plasmapolymerized thin films was carried out by capacitance-voltage and current-voltage measurements. The organic thinfilm transistor device with gate dielectric of the plasma polymerized thin film revealed a low operation voltage of -10V and a low threshold voltage of -3 V. It was confirmed that plasma polymerized thin films of styrene and vinyl acetatecould be applied to functional organic thin film transistor devices as the gate dielectric.

      • GAN 마스크 제거 학습을 이용한 얼굴인식 기법

        임재성,송민석,홍충표 한국차세대컴퓨팅학회 2022 한국차세대컴퓨팅학회 학술대회 Vol.2022 No.05

        본 논문에서는 마스크를 착용한 얼굴 이미지에서 GAN을 통해 마스크를 제거한 이미지를 생성하고 신원을 확인하는 시스템을 제안한다. 이 시스템은 RetinaFace 모델을 이용하여 마스크를 착용한 얼굴을 탐지하고, 탐지된 얼굴의 마스크 영역을 GAN으로 생성한 다음, 생성한 얼굴을 ArcFace 모델로 임베딩 한다. 기존 데이터베이스에 등록된 얼굴과 GAN으로 생성한 얼굴의 임베딩 벡터 사이의 Angular Cosine Distance를 측정하여 동일 인물인지 판단하는 매칭 알고리즘을 제안한다.

      • 전부요도손상환자에서 요도경하 일차적 요도정렬술의 임상적 고찰

        임재성 충남대학교 의과대학 의학연구소 2003 충남의대잡지 Vol.30 No.1

        Straddle injuries to the anterior urethra should always be managed by urinary diversion and delayed repair because the crush injury makes delineation of the healthy margin difficult. The trend towards primary urethral realignment may prevent the need for definitive urethroplasty in a these patients. Between May 2001 and Mar. 2003 among 7 patients with trauma of anterior urethra were treated by endoscopically guided primary urethra1 realignment. Of the 5 incomplete ruptures, 4 had excellent results without stricture from 3 months to 2 years. Then 1 had focal urethral stricture, which could be easily treated with visual internal urethrotomy. Of the 2 complete ruptures, focal urethral stricture, which could be easily treated with visual internal urethrotomy. Complications including acute pyelonephritis and urinary tract infection were seen in one patients respectively. Endoscopically guided primary urethral realignment offers more simple and effective than delayed repair.
